Understanding Custom Software Development
Custom software development refers to the process of designing software applications tailored specifically to the needs of a particular business or user. Unlike off-the-shelf software, which aims to meet general requirements, custom solutions address unique challenges and help streamline operations. This process includes several stages: planning, design, development, testing, deployment, and maintenance.
Emerging Trends in Custom Software Development
1. No-Code and Low-Code Development Platforms
No-code and low-code platforms are transforming the landscape of custom software development by empowering non-technical users to create applications with minimal programming knowledge. This democratizes the development process, enabling businesses to accelerate app delivery and reduce reliance on IT resources. As such, organizations can respond more rapidly to changing business needs and foster innovation without heavy investments in development teams.
2. AI and Machine Learning Integration
The integration of Artificial Intelligence (AI) and Machine Learning (ML) into custom software solutions is reshaping how businesses operate. These technologies enable software to analyze vast amounts of data, identify patterns, and make predictions. By leveraging AI and ML, companies can enhance user experiences, streamline operations, and make data-driven decisions. As these technologies continue to evolve, custom software development will increasingly focus on harnessing their power for practical applications.
3. Cloud-Native Development
The shift towards cloud-native development is a major trend that allows businesses to build scalable and flexible applications. Cloud-native architectures leverage microservices, containerization, and DevOps practices, providing organizations with the agility to respond to market demands quickly. By developing custom software in the cloud, companies can also reduce infrastructure costs and improve collaboration among development teams.
The Role of Agile Methodology
Agile methodology has become synonymous with modern software development due to its emphasis on iterative progress, collaboration, and flexibility. In custom software development, Agile allows teams to break projects into manageable modules and focus on delivering incremental improvements. This iterative approach enables businesses to adapt to changing requirements, identify issues early, and enhance customer satisfaction by delivering features that align closely with user needs.
Essential Tools for Custom Software Development
1. Version Control Systems
Version control systems, such as Git, play a pivotal role in custom software development by enabling multiple developers to work collaboratively on a codebase while keeping track of changes. This reduces the risk of conflicts, allows for easy rollbacks, and improves overall project management.
2. Integrated Development Environments (IDEs)
IDEs, like Visual Studio and Eclipse, provide a comprehensive environment for developers to write, test, and debug code. These tools enhance productivity by offering features such as code suggestions, error highlighting, and built-in testing capabilities, helping developers streamline their workflow and improve code quality.
3. Project Management Tools
Effective project management is crucial for successful custom software development. Tools like Jira and Trello enable teams to track progress, allocate resources, and manage tasks efficiently. By implementing these solutions, businesses can ensure that projects remain on schedule and within budget while maintaining transparency and accountability.
Challenges in Custom Software Development
1. Scope Creep
One of the most prevalent challenges in custom software development is scope creep, where project requirements evolve beyond the original objectives. This can lead to delays, budget overruns, and team frustration. Effective communication and well-defined project specifications are essential to mitigate scope creep.
2. Security Concerns
As organizations become more reliant on digital solutions, ensuring the security of custom software is paramount. Developers must prioritize implementing best practices for security throughout the software development lifecycle, such as regular vulnerability assessments and adherence to secure coding standards, to protect sensitive data from breaches.
Best Practices for Successful Custom Software Development
1. Collaborate with Stakeholders
Engaging stakeholders throughout the development process is critical for ensuring that the final product meets user needs. Regular feedback loops and collaborative workshops help align expectations and yield a better understanding of desired features and functionality.
2. Focus on User Experience (UX)
User experience should be at the forefront of custom software development. A well-designed interface that prioritizes user needs can greatly enhance satisfaction and encourage adoption. Conducting user testing and gathering feedback during the design phase will help refine the final product and create a more intuitive experience.
3. Continuous Improvement
The landscape of custom software development is ever-changing. To remain competitive, businesses should foster a culture of continuous improvement, where teams regularly evaluate and enhance their processes, tools, and technologies. This not only improves the development process but also increases the overall quality of the software produced.
